In modern retail, PDQ display trays—an abbreviation for *"Pretty Darn Quick" display units*—have become indispensable visual tools for product promotion and impulse sales. From convenience stores to supermarkets, these cardboard point-of-purchase (POP) solutions help brands attract attention, organize products efficiently, and communicate sustainability.

PDQ display trays, sometimes called counter display units (CDUs) or shelf-ready packaging (SRP), are designed for quick assembly and immediate product placement. Typically made from corrugated cardboard, they serve both as product containers and attention-grabbing retail displays.
Key characteristics:
- Fully customizable dimensions, graphics, and branding.
- Easy to assemble and transport.
- Suitable for small packaged goods, from snacks to skincare items.
- Made from 100% recyclable and biodegradable materials.
As Australian retailers increasingly favor eco-friendly display solutions, demand for PDQ trays continues to grow across industries including FMCG, pharmaceuticals, and electronics accessories.
When selecting a supplier, retailers and distributors must consider design accuracy, manufacturing standards, and logistics reliability. Whether you're sourcing locally in Australia or working with overseas partners like Long Win Display, focus on these factors:
1. Creative Engineering: Manufacturers should turn product concepts into stable, retail-ready designs.
2. High Print Quality: Crisp logos and brand colors help displays stand out on crowded shelves.
3. Prototyping Services: 3D visuals and pre-production samples reduce risk before mass production.
4. Material Compliance: Non-toxic inks and recyclable boards ensure environmental compliance.
5. Efficient Delivery: Timely shipment and flexible packaging formats (pre-assembled or flat-packed).
A manufacturer integrating all these aspects ensures a seamless experience from concept to retail launch.

Australia's retail evolution towards sustainability is accelerating. According to a 2025 Deloitte Australia Report, 68% of consumers prefer brands that adopt eco-friendly display and packaging materials.
Sustainability innovations now include:
- Using recycled corrugated boards instead of virgin fiber.
- Substituting plastic coating with water-based protective varnish.
- Designing multi-use or stackable PDQ units for extended lifetime.

Based on recent retail data and supplier surveys, these are the five most significant trends in 2026:
- Advanced Digital Printing: Enables vibrant, photo-quality graphics for short promotional runs.
- Interactive Design Elements: Displays now feature QR codes connecting shoppers to digital content.
- Local-Global Supply Integration: Many Australian importers are building dual sourcing models: local assembly plus global procurement.
- Retail-Specific Engineering: Custom shapes designed for category optimization, e.g. cosmetics vs. beverages.
- Circular Economy Practices: Encouraging brands to reuse or recycle display materials after campaigns.
These trends reinforce the shift from disposable design to sustainable retail innovation.
